On July 9, 1846, Congress agreed to return all of the territory that Virginia had ceded. Therefore, the district's space consists solely of the portion originally donated by Maryland. Confirming the fears of pro-slavery Alexandrians, the Compromise of 1850 outlawed the slave trade in the District, although not slavery itself. Various tribes of the Algonquian-speaking Piscataway individuals inhabited the lands around the Potomac River when Europeans first visited the world within the early 17th century. One group often recognized as the Nacotchtank maintained settlements across the Anacostia River throughout the present-day District of Columbia.

Until 1890, the Census Bureau counted the City of Washington, Georgetown, and unincorporated portions of Washington County as three separate areas. The information offered in this article from earlier than 1890 are calculated as if the District of Columbia had been a single municipality as it's today. Population data for each metropolis previous to 1890 are available.

By 1870, the district's inhabitants had grown 75% from the previous census to simply about 132,000 residents. Despite town's growth, Washington nonetheless had filth roads and lacked primary sanitation. Some members of Congress instructed transferring the capital further west, however President Ulysses S. Grant refused to contemplate such a proposal. The federal Height of Buildings Act of 1910 allows buildings which are no taller than the width of the adjoining street, plus 20 toes (6.1 m). Despite in style perception, no legislation has ever limited buildings to the peak of the United States Capitol Building or the 555-foot Washington Monument, which stays the district's tallest structure. City leaders have criticized the height restriction as a primary cause why the district has limited inexpensive housing and site visitors issues brought on by suburban sprawl. The infrequent wet, gentle snow typically melts shortly, as average winter daytime temperatures are in the mid-30s F (about 2 °C); nevertheless, freezing temperatures at night can quickly change the melted snow to ice. In the summer time brief periods of excessive temperatures are frequent, usually accompanied by dense humidity. The average summer time daytime temperatures are in the mid-70s F (about 24 °C), however highs above 100 °F (about 39 °C) can happen.
